Another advance for Jars

This CD is even better than the self titled release. For anyone who was disapointed with the 11th hour, this CD takes away all the pain. It's unique with its great blend of techniques with a tiny bit of bluegrass flair (please, no one be turned off by this, I did not say that it is twangy) The messages are as good as ever, just look at the lyrics to "jealous kind". This is a truly unique and beautiful cd. Jars has advanced and there isn't a song on it that isn't worthwhile.

Who is this masquerading as Jars?

I bought this album sight unseen (sound unheard?), I owned all four of Jars' previous albums, and while I believed they had faltered somewhat with Eleventh Hour, I felt that Jars was incapable of producing a bad album. I stand corrected; this album is practically unlistenable, save the unfortunately brief "I'm in the Way". Who are these people, and what have they done with Jars of Clay? I have long considered Much Afraid one of the best albums in my collection, but it has been all downhill since then. If I Left the Zoo was an excellent effort, and Eleventh Hour has several good cuts, but all Who we are Instead has to offer is some horrendous country/folk stylings. Unfortunately, this trend doesn't show signs of reversing any time soon, and this, coupled with the disbanding of Sixpence None the Richer, leaves me with little reason to listen to any "Christian" music. Pity.
